Maple GO Station
Railway station
Photo: Reaperexpress,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Maple GO Station is a train and bus station on GO Transit's Barrie line, located in Vaughan, Ontario, Canada. It is Ontario's oldest operating railway station, with passenger service dating back to 1853. Maple GO Station is situated 2 km northwest of RoyalCrest Academy.
Stephen Lewis Secondary School
School
Stephen Lewis Secondary School is a public semestered high school in Vaughan, Ontario, Canada administered by the York Region District School Board. Currently, the school enrols students in grades 9, 10, 11 and 12, all of which are from the "Vaughan Block 10" region. Stephen Lewis Secondary School is situated 1½ km southeast of RoyalCrest Academy.

Medieval Faire
Locality
Photo: Zanimum,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Originally themed around the Middle Ages, Medieval Faire is a section of Canada's Wonderland, a theme park in Vaughan, Ontario, Canada. As such, early attractions created under Kings Entertainment Company were named after knights, Don Quixote, Vikings, dragons, bats, and beasts. Medieval Faire is situated 4½ km west of RoyalCrest Academy.
